ошибка cmake mantaflow

Компьютерная графика

CMake Error at CMakeLists.txt:654 (add_executable):
Target "manta" links to item
/home/yy/anaconda3/envs/den2vel_ENV/lib/libpython3.7m.so "
which has leading or trailing whitespace. This is now an error according to policy CMP0004.
окрестности:
ubuntu16.04 + anaconda
Анализ причин:
Как вы можете видеть из отладки, это связано с тем, что за объектом, с которым связана манта, находится куча пустых строк.
Объект ссылки можно увидеть из выходной информации cmake:PYTHON_LIBRARIES. Глядя на определение этого объекта, вы можете увидеть
set(PYTHON_LIBRARIES ${PYTHON_LIBRARY})
Таким образом, вы можете изменить эту переменную.
Решение:
set(PYTHON_LIBRARY "/home/yy/anaconda3/envs/lib/libpython3.7m.so") # alternatively, set manually here
Измените его на:
set(PYTHON_LIBRARY "/home/yy/anaconda3/envs/den2vel_ENV/lib/libpython3.7m.so") # alternatively, set manually here.